Syllabus

Course Code: BCA-408    Course Name: COMPUTER NETWORKS – II

MODULE NO / UNIT COURSE SYLLABUS CONTENTS OF MODULE NOTES
1 Introduction to the Internet and its History. Internet Structure. TCP/IP architecture and its major Protocols. Comparison of TCP/IP and OSI reference Model. Overview of Internet based communications and access devices. Dialup Networking. Analog Modem Concepts. DSL Service. Cable Modems. Leased lines. Home Networking Concepts.
2 Transport layer: Services, Port Numbers. The Transport Control Protocol (TCP) . Establishing and closing a TCP connection. The User Datagram Protocol (UDP). The Internet Protocol (IP ). IPv4 and its addressing. Need for IPv6.
3 Internet Routing Protocols: OSPF, BGP, RIP. Application Layer: Standard Client-Server Services and Protocols. World Wide Web. HTTP. FTP. Electronic mail. TELNET. Secure Shell(SSH). DNS. IP address resolution using DNS. Introduction to Network Management.
4 Network Security Issues: Security Goals. Threat Assessment. Network Attacks. Encryption Methods: Symmetric and Asymmetric-Key Ciphers. Firewalls, Digital Signatures, Authentication and Access Control Methods: Digital Certificates, Smart Cards, Kerberos. Virtual Private Networks and Internet Security. IP Security Protocol (IPSec).
Copyright © 2020 Kurukshetra University, Kurukshetra. All Rights Reserved.